Two weeks after announcing the AEW Women s World Championship Eliminator Tournament to determine the #1 contender, we finally have a full list of entrants, along with confirmation the tournament will have a US side and a Japan side. There s still a lot we don t know (When will the tournament start? Where will it be broadcast? Is this title shot for Revolution or sometime afterwards?) but at the very least, we can look at who all is in the tournament, check out their past and present, and see if an AEW Women s World Championship shot is in their future.
Darby Allin will look for the second defense of his TNT Championship on next week s AEW Dynamite as he defends against Joey Janela.
Part of the storyline of the match was set up during Beach Break as Team Taz threatened to interject while Sting promised to be there to ensure the match remains one-on-one.
Janela hasn t won a singles match in AEW since November 11th and has been mainly involved in tag team matches since then.
Only two other matches were announced for next week:
Chris Jericho & MJF vs. The Acclaimed: This was set up before Wednesday s tag team battle royal when Max Caster walked out and began his rap as The Inner Circle were still on the stage waiting to enter the ring area. Caster later eliminated MJF from the battle royal, but Jericho ended up picking up the win and Tag Team title shot for his team.

Before we get to that, we need to cover the main event of the evening. Jon Moxley, PAC, & Fenix went to battle against Kenny Omega, Karl Anderson, & Luke Gallows. The babyfaces were on fire early with aggression until Omega held PAC’s foot on the turnbuckles for Gallows to land a high kick and then press him into the air. The match progressed with a steady flow of high flying and powerful suplexes.
